Full Monthly Breakdown for Suva

1BR Apartment (Centre)€350/mo
1BR Apartment (Outside)€250/mo
3BR Apartment (Centre)€770/mo
Groceries (single)€200/mo
Transport pass€20/mo
Utilities€89/mo
Internet€18/mo
Health insurance€37/mo
Entertainment & dining€59/mo
Total single (centre)€740/mo
Family of 4 (centre)€1 500/mo

What You Can Earn in Fiji

Typical gross annual salaries in Fiji by sector (entry · median · senior). Suva pay usually sits around the national median.

SectorEntryMedianSenior
it€12 500€18 000€25 000
retail€5 000€7 500€10 500
finance€10 000€14 000€19 500
education€7 000€10 000€14 000
healthcare€8 500€12 000€17 000
engineering€11 000€16 000€22 500
hospitality€6 000€8 500€12 000
construction€7 500€11 000€15 500

Visa Routes to Fiji

Affording Suva is only half the question — you also need a visa that lets you stay in Fiji. The main routes:

  • A job offer is normally required for the main work route.
  • Permanent residence after about 5 years.
  • Citizenship after ~5 years — dual nationality allowed.
  • Investment route from about €21 000 (USD).

Taxes in Fiji

14.2%
Effective @ €90k

Top marginal rate 30%, VAT 12.5%.

Settling into Suva

  • Foreigners can open a local bank account in Fiji.
  • Budget around €2 100 for first-month setup in Suva.
  • Regulated professions needing credential recognition: Medicine, Engineering, Law, Nursing, Teaching.
